Which following parameters correlates best with measurements of the body's total protein stores?

a.Height
b.Weight
c.Skinfold thickness
d.Upper arm circumference

Final answer:

Upper arm circumference most accurately correlates with the body's total protein stores, as it accounts for both muscle mass and subcutaneous fat, providing a good estimate of protein reserves.

Step-by-step explanation:

The correlation of body protein stores with different physical parameters can delineate the best indicators of nutritional status. Skinfold thickness, using calipers, is a commonly employed method to measure body fat and indirectly assess total body protein. However, upper arm circumference is considered a more reliable measure for assessing the protein reserves in the body than height, weight, or skinfold thickness. Upper arm circumference takes into account both the muscle mass (which contains the majority of the body's protein) and subcutaneous fat, offering a better approximation of body protein stores.

Measuring upper arm circumference provides a noninvasive and fairly accurate method for estimating the muscle mass component of body protein stores. Measuring fat distribution is also important, and techniques like the waist-to-hip ratio can provide insight into health risks associated with obesity to complement body protein estimates. However, this waist-to-hip ratio is more focused on fat distribution rather than total protein reserves.
